X
Start Chat
Close

This business is currently offline. Please try again later.

Close

Document Image Processing Systems in Cardigan, Dyfed

  1. Trans Media Technology Ltd

    Local Document Image Processing Systems in Cardigan, Dyfed
    01792 581441
    01792 581441
    66.9 miles
  2. Oasis

    Local Document Image Processing Systems in Cardigan, Dyfed
    01873 811803
    01873 811803
    104.2 miles
1 - 2 of 2
X

Loading more results...

Privacy Policy